Output 8281160e51ae808250c9cc21408c9140bb257d913cd630b63f0bfeafe79f182a:3

value
23640
script pubkey
OP_0 OP_PUSHBYTES_20 e8c21f46d63a29d13e4b1083c2747d7f91e541ef
address
bc1qarpp73kk8g5az0jtzzpuyara07g72s00muanmt
transaction
8281160e51ae808250c9cc21408c9140bb257d913cd630b63f0bfeafe79f182a